Prototype

The object that has the greatest number of attributes characteristic of the concept and that is therefore the most typical member of that concept.

Attribute

A feature of an object or event that varies from one instance to another.

Genotype

The genetic makeup of an individual organism, consisting of the inherited alleles that dictate traits or characteristics.
